基于改进的粒子群算法的MEMS移相器设计

Design of MEMS phase shifter based on improved particle swarm optimization algorithm

  • 摘要: 针对射频微机电系统(MEMS)移相器在传统设计过程中参数的复杂性和关联性以及设计过程繁琐等问题,提出了一种基于混合自适应变异粒子群算法设计的新思路。通过将改进后的粒子群算法运用到MEMS移相器性能的研究中,简化其设计过程。与传统的设计方法相比,节省了大量的时间并表现出优良的性能,实现了0度90度任意相移量,而且移相器的相移精度也显著提高。结论表明该方法能够有效的应用于MEMS移相器的设计。

     

    Abstract: Considering the complicacy,relevance,and low design efficiency in the conventional design of a MEMS phase shifter,an innovative idea,which adopts Hybrid Adaptive Mutation Particle Swarm Optimization,is proposed. Then,this new algorithm is applied to research the property of a MEMS phase shifter,which simplifies its design process. Co MParing with the conventional design,the new method can save plenty of time and show high property. Besides,the phase shifter can obtain phase shift from 0 to 90 deg and a high phase accuracy. The improved method can be applied to the design of MEMS phase shifter.
